2010-02-25 16:59:42
在敏捷项目管理中,迭代周期的选择至关重要。文章指出,迭代周期越短,学习速度越快,但同时也伴随着更多的会议和准备时间。以三个月为周期,三周迭代花费约7%的时间在迭代会议上,有4次改进机会;两周迭代则花费约10%,有6次机会;一周迭代则花费约20%,有12次机会。虽然短周期会降低效率,但学习效率的提升更为显著。文章还讨论了不同项目可能需要不同频率的会议和活动,以及如何通过实践和调整来优化迭代周期。
2010-02-25 16:59:42
在敏捷项目管理中,迭代周期的选择至关重要。文章指出,迭代周期越短,学习速度越快,但同时也伴随着更多的会议和准备时间。以三个月为周期,三周迭代花费约7%的时间在迭代会议上,有4次改进机会;两周迭代则花费约10%,有6次机会;一周迭代则花费约20%,有12次机会。虽然短周期会降低效率,但学习效率的提升更为显著。文章还讨论了不同项目可能需要不同频率的会议和活动,以及如何通过实践和调整来优化迭代周期。
2010-02-21 21:00:00
作者在优化XML API性能时,尝试了从rexml切换到Nokogiri库,但发现性能提升不明显。经过反思,发现API调用主要是简单的HTTP请求,而XML渲染速度慢是问题所在。作者尝试使用Nokogiri XML builder替代Rails中的Builder库,并通过基准测试发现,对于较长的模板,Nokogiri带来了4.5倍的速度提升,显著提高了API的响应速度。
2010-02-21 20:09:57
近日,作者发起了名为“铁博客”的活动,旨在鼓励朋友们更频繁地更新博客。活动始于一条简单的提议:每周至少更新一篇博客,否则需向集体啤酒基金支付5美元。目前已有42人参与,共发表307篇博客,平均每人7.3篇,每周0.8篇。活动还设有啤酒基金,用于奖励坚持更新的参与者。